Dining Aide

Location: The Marquardt
Watertown WI 53098

We are seeking a Dining Aide to join our team. The ideal candidate will have a positive attitude, excellent customer service skills, and the ability to work on their feet for extended periods of time. No experience is required for this position.

New Horizon Foods is a dining contract company that specializes in providing services tailored to the location and client. We have been in operation for over 30 years and are currently in more than 10 states. Our employees are our greatest asset and reason for our success. Great employees make great experiences.

Benefits:

  • Flexible hours
  • NO Late Nights!
  • On the job training
  • Ability to advance in the company
  • Health benefits for Full Time employees
  • PTO for Full Time employees

Responsibilities:

  • Assist with meal preparation and serving
  • Ensure that all food is presented in an attractive and appetizing manner
  • Provide excellent customer service to residents and guests
  • Assist with cleaning and sanitizing the kitchen and dining areas
  • Follow all safety and sanitation procedures

Requirements:

  • Positive attitude and excellent customer service skills
  • Ability to work on feet for extended periods of time
  • Reliable means of transportation to and from work
  • No experience required
